1,380,379,532 is an even composite number composed of six prime numbers multiplied together.
1380379532 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of ninety-six divisors.
Prime factorization of 1380379532:
22 × 7 × 17 × 31 × 139 × 673
(2 × 2 × 7 × 17 × 31 × 139 × 673)See below for interesting mathematical facts about the number 1380379532 from the Numbermatics database.

-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 3043676160
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 1663296628
- 1380379532 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(1663296628)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 282917096
